Who is RiotUSA?
RiotUSA, whose birth name is Ephrem Louis Lopez, Jr., was born in Manhattan and raised in the Bronx, New York. Coming from a musically inclined family, RiotUSA’s father is DJ Enuff, a renowned radio personality and disc jockey.
How Did RiotUSA Begin His Career?
At the age of ten, He started experimenting with beats using GarageBand. His early exposure to music, combined with his natural talent, set the stage for his future in music production.

Career Milestones
The Breakthrough
He gained widespread attention in 2022 with Ice Spice’s viral single “Munch (Feelin’ U)”, which he produced. The song exploded on platforms like TikTok and Twitter, gaining recognition from industry giants like Drake.
Major Collaborations
- Produced Ice Spice’s hit singles: “Bikini Bottom” and “In Ha Mood.”
- Executive producer of Ice Spice’s debut EP, Like..?, released in 2023.
- Co-wrote and produced “Barbie World”, featuring Nicki Minaj and Aqua, for the Barbie (2023) movie soundtrack.
- Co-wrote the remix of Taylor Swift’s “Karma”, featuring Ice Spice.
Publishing Deal
In 2023, He signed a global publishing deal with Warner Chappell Music, solidifying his position in the industry.

Collaboration with Ice Spice
How Did RiotUSA and Ice Spice Meet?
He met Ice Spice while attending the State University of New York at Purchase. Their shared passion for music led to a successful creative partnership.
Are RiotUSA and Ice Spice Related?
No, Riot and Ice Spice are not related. They are collaborators and close friends in the music industry.

Awards and Nominations
His talent has been recognized with nominations for prestigious awards:
Year | Award Ceremony | Category | Result |
---|---|---|---|
2024 | 66th Annual Grammy Awards | Best Song Written for Visual Media | Nominated |
2024 | 66th Annual Grammy Awards | Best Rap Song | Nominated |
